Taxonomic Classification
| Rank | Alpine Emerald | Ecuadorean Akodont |
|---|---|---|
| Kingdom same | Animalia (Animals) | Animalia (Animals) |
| Phylum | Arthropoda (Arthropods) | Chordata (Chordates) |
| Class | Insecta (Insects) | Mammalia (Mammals) |
| Order | Odonata (Odonata) | Rodentia (Rodents) |
| Family | Corduliidae | Cricetidae |
| Genus | Somatochlora | Neomicroxus |
| Species | Somatochlora alpestris | Neomicroxus latebricola |

Ecuadorean Akodont
Found across multiple habitat types including tropical and subtropical dry broadleaf forests, flooded grasslands and savannas, and montane grasslands and shrublands, among 4 distinct biome types within the Neotropic biogeographic realm.
Found in Ecuador. Currently classified as Endangered on the IUCN Red List, this species faces significant conservation challenges across its range.
